How they compare
Sri Lanka currently reports 415.8 1000 USD against 357.76 1000 USD in Caribbean (excluding intra-trade), a difference of 58.04 1000 USD.
That makes Sri Lanka's figure about 1.2 times Caribbean (excluding intra-trade)'s.
The two have swapped places 11 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Caribbean (excluding intra-trade) ahead.
Caribbean (excluding intra-trade) ranks 67th and Sri Lanka ranks 65th of 177 countries.
Caribbean (excluding intra-trade) has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
